The Stuff That Never Happened
by Maddie Dawson
The Stuff That Never Happened (9/19/2010)
This book is a fun, engaging read. The main character, Annabelle, is witty, complex, and at times, naive. Annabelle's relationships with her mother and daughter add another interesting dimension to the plot. This book should be of particular interest to women like me who grew up during the seventies. Although somewhat predictable, I thoroughly enjoyed this novel.
The Journal Keeper: A Memoir
by Phyllis Theroux
a keeper... (1/26/2010)
My shelves are overflowing with books, so much so that I can't keep them all; however, I will keep and treasure this book. The Journal Keeper is a thought provoking, sometimes depressing, sometimes uplifting read. I have highlighted many passages, and each time I pick it up, I find more to highlight. The everyday events of the author's life are intertwined with her writing life. Her themes are universal and honest. I learned from and often identified with this extraordinary memoir.
While My Sister Sleeps
by Barbara Delinsky
thought provoking (1/14/2009)
I enjoyed this book and found it to be quite thought provoking. It forced me to think about difficult issues, and how I would confront them.
I did find the book to be lacking in character development. I never felt as if I truly knew the characters. It left me wanting more.
